What is the equivalent of 3 4 in fractions?
Example Equivalent Fractions. Find fractions equivalent to 3/4 by multiplying the numerator and denominator by the same whole number: 3 4 × 2 2 = 6 8. 3 4 × 3 3 = 9 12. 3 4 × 4 4 = 12 16. 3 4 × 5 5 = 15 20. 3 4 × 6 6 = 18 24. Therefore these are all equivalent fractions: 3 4 = 6 8 = 9 12 = 15 20 = 18 24.

How do you find 2/5 of a number?
Solved examples for finding a fraction of a whole number: So, 1/3 of 21 = 7. (ii) Find 2/5 of 15. To find 2/5 of 15, we multiply the numerator 2 by the given whole number 15 and then divide the product 30 by the denominator 5. So, 2/5 of 15 = 6.

Is a equivalent fraction?
Equivalent fractions are two or more fractions that are all equal even though they different numerators and denominators. For example the fraction 1/2 is equivalent to (or the same as) 25/50 or 500/1000. Each time the fraction in its simplest form is ‘one half’.

How do you find the equivalent ratio?
Thus, to find a ratio equivalent to another we have to multiply the two quantities, by the same number. Another way to find equivalent ratios is to convert the given ratio into fraction form and then multiply the numerator and denominator by the same number to get equivalent fractions.

How to make a fraction equivalent?
Multiply both the numerator and denominator of a fraction by the same whole number. As long as you multiply both top and bottom of the fraction by the same number, you won’t change the value of the fraction , and you’ll create an equivalent fraction.
What are Equivalent Fractions?
Equivalent fractions are fractions with different numbers representing the same part of a whole. They have different numerators and denominators, but their fractional values are the same.
What is half of a fraction?
For example, think about the fraction 1/2. It means half of something. You can also say that 6/12 is half, and that 50/100 is half. They represent the same part of the whole. These equivalent fractions contain different numbers but they mean the same thing: 1/2 = 6/12 = 50/100

Does multiplying by 1 change the value of a fraction?
Recall that multiplying any number by 1 does not change its value. 1 can be written as 2 2, 3 3, 4 4, 9 9, 15 15, 21 21 50 50… If you multiply the top and bottom of a fraction by the same number you do not change its value, only what it looks like.

How to convert decimals to fractions?
It does however require the understanding that each decimal place to the right of the decimal point represents a power of 10; the first decimal place being 10 1, the second 10 2, the third 10 3, and so on. Simply determine what power of 10 the decimal extends to , use that power of 10 as the denominator, enter each number to the right of the decimal point as the numerator, and simplify. For example, looking at the number 0.1234, the number 4 is in the fourth decimal place which constitutes 10 4, or 10,000. How to find common denominator of fractions?
One method for finding a common denominator involves multiplying the numerators and denominators of all of the fractions involved by the product of the denominators of each fraction. Multiplying all of the denominators ensures that the new denominator is certain to be a multiple of each individual denominator. The numerators also need to be multiplied by the appropriate factors to preserve the value of the fraction as a whole. This is arguably the simplest way to ensure that the fractions have a common denominator. Is 15:25 equal to 3:5?
The given ratios 3: 5 and 15: 25 are equal. Because when you divide the ratio 15: 25 by 5 on both numerator and denominator, the first ratio 3: 5 can be obtained. Similarly, when you multiply the first ratio 3: 5 by 5, the ratio 15: 25 can be obtained.
